Definitions

• Earned income – wages, salaries, tips

• Unearned income – child support, interest income, gifts, allowances, prizes

• Budget – a planning tool that can be used to help individuals and families manage their money.

Page 9: Warm-Up--What Do You Know About Budgets? Use a Word table to create a KWL Chart (or copy and paste one from an earlier activity). What do you know? What.

Expenses

• Money paid out of your monthly income – Fixed – the same every month (car payment)– Variable –may vary every month (clothing)

Monthly Salary Calculation

Payment Interval Multiply By Divide By

each week 52 12

every 2 weeks 26 12

twice a month 24 12

every 3 weeks 17.34 12

*Include other income such as interest or other.

Page 12: Warm-Up--What Do You Know About Budgets? Use a Word table to create a KWL Chart (or copy and paste one from an earlier activity). What do you know? What.

• Paid $1600 bimonthly

• 1600 X 24 = 38,400/12 = 3200

Category %

Housing 28.3

Transportation 23.9

Food 10.8

Personal insurance and pensions 9.1

Personal taxes 5.7

Entertainment 5.2

Clothing and services 4.3

Health care 3.9

Miscellaneous expenses 2.3

Education 2.1

Personal care products and services 1.0

Cash Contributions .6

Reading .5

Savings 2.3

Total 100.

Typical Budget Percentages
